Selection Guidance

Careful consideration should be given before acquiring themed carrying solutions. The following guidance aims to inform prospective purchasers of options within this product category.

Tip 1: Assess Capacity Needs: Prior to purchase, determine the volume required for carrying daily essentials. Backpacks vary in size and storage compartments. A larger capacity is advisable for carrying textbooks or electronic devices, while a smaller option may suffice for lighter loads.

Tip 2: Evaluate Material Durability: Examine the construction materials. Options range from polyester to nylon. Durable materials are preferable for withstanding daily wear and tear. Reinforced stitching and water-resistant coatings contribute to longevity.

Tip 3: Consider Ergonomic Design: Look for features that enhance comfort. Padded shoulder straps and back panels distribute weight evenly and reduce strain. Adjustable straps allow for a customized fit.

Tip 4: Examine Character Integration: Thematic elements should be incorporated tastefully. Subdued designs featuring subtle character references may be more suitable for professional settings. Bold graphics are appropriate for casual use.

Tip 5: Verify Licensing Authenticity: Ensure the product is officially licensed by The Walt Disney Company. Licensed merchandise guarantees adherence to quality standards and supports the copyright holder.

Tip 6: Review Compartmental Organization: Internal and external pockets aid in organization. Dedicated compartments for laptops, water bottles, and smaller items enhance functionality.

These points are intended to guide informed decision-making, increasing satisfaction and ensuring product suitability for individual needs.

5. Material Quality

5. Material Quality, Disney Backpacks

Material quality is a critical determinant of the longevity, functionality, and overall value of character-themed bags designed for male consumers. The selection of appropriate materials impacts a product’s durability, aesthetic appeal, and ability to withstand daily wear and tear. Disregard for material quality can lead to premature product failure, diminished consumer satisfaction, and negative brand perception.

  • Durability and Longevity

    The selection of robust materials directly correlates with a bag’s ability to withstand the stresses of daily use. High-denier nylon, reinforced stitching, and durable zippers contribute to the product’s lifespan. Bags constructed from inferior materials are prone to tearing, seam separation, and zipper malfunctions, leading to premature replacement. For example, a bag constructed from low-grade polyester is unlikely to withstand the weight of textbooks or electronic devices, whereas a bag made from ballistic nylon offers superior resistance to abrasion and tearing.

  • Weather Resistance

    Materials offering water resistance or water repellency provide protection for the contents of the bag, especially in inclement weather conditions. Fabrics treated with durable water repellent (DWR) coatings prevent water from penetrating the material, safeguarding electronics, documents, and personal items. The absence of weather-resistant properties can lead to water damage, mold growth, and equipment malfunction. A bag made from untreated canvas is susceptible to water absorption, whereas a bag constructed from coated nylon offers superior protection against rain and spills.

  • Aesthetic Appeal and Texture

    Material choice influences the visual and tactile qualities of the bag, contributing to its overall aesthetic appeal. High-quality materials exhibit a superior texture, drape, and color fastness, enhancing the product’s perceived value. Conversely, inferior materials may appear cheap, faded, or prone to wrinkling. The incorporation of premium materials, such as leather accents or custom-printed fabrics, elevates the bag’s aesthetic and sets it apart from mass-produced alternatives. A bag constructed from low-grade vinyl may appear shiny and artificial, while a bag made from waxed canvas offers a rugged and sophisticated appearance.

  • Weight and Comfort

    The weight of the material contributes to the overall comfort and ease of carrying the bag. Lightweight materials minimize strain on the user’s shoulders and back, particularly when carrying heavy loads. The incorporation of padded shoulder straps and breathable back panels further enhances comfort during extended use. Bags constructed from excessively heavy materials can lead to fatigue and discomfort. A bag made from thick, non-breathable cotton may be uncomfortable to wear for extended periods, while a bag constructed from lightweight nylon with mesh padding offers superior comfort and ventilation.

6. Official Licensing

6. Official Licensing, Disney Backpacks

Official licensing represents a fundamental aspect of merchandise associated with The Walt Disney Company, including bags marketed toward male consumers. This authorization ensures adherence to quality standards, legal compliance, and brand protection, thereby impacting product integrity and consumer trust.

  • Intellectual Property Protection

    Official licensing safeguards Disney’s intellectual property rights, encompassing characters, logos, and trademarks. Unauthorized use of these assets constitutes infringement, potentially leading to legal action. Licensed manufacturers are granted the legal right to utilize Disney’s intellectual property, ensuring compliance with copyright laws. For instance, a bag featuring a Mickey Mouse design must be produced under an official license to avoid legal repercussions.

  • Quality Control and Standards

    Licensing agreements stipulate quality control measures that manufacturers must adhere to. These standards govern material selection, production processes, and product durability, ensuring that licensed bags meet Disney’s quality expectations. Non-compliance with these standards may result in the revocation of the license. For example, licensed bag manufacturers must utilize specific materials and construction techniques to ensure the product’s longevity and resistance to wear and tear.

  • Revenue Distribution and Royalties

    Licensing agreements outline the distribution of revenue generated from the sale of licensed products. A percentage of the revenue, known as royalties, is paid to Disney as compensation for the use of its intellectual property. These royalties contribute to Disney’s overall revenue stream and fund future content creation. The price of officially licensed bags reflects these royalty payments, potentially resulting in a higher cost compared to unauthorized merchandise.

  • Brand Authenticity and Consumer Trust

    Official licensing serves as a mark of authenticity, assuring consumers that they are purchasing genuine Disney merchandise. Licensed bags typically feature branding elements, such as hangtags or labels, indicating their authorized status. Consumers often associate licensed products with higher quality and reliability, enhancing their purchasing confidence. The presence of an official Disney license can differentiate a product from counterfeit or imitation goods, bolstering consumer trust and brand loyalty.

Frequently Asked Questions

The subsequent section addresses common inquiries related to the selection, purchasing, and maintenance of character-themed carrying solutions for men.

Question 1: What factors should be considered when selecting a bag featuring Disney characters for a professional setting?

In professional contexts, subdued designs and subtle character representations are often preferable. The character should be incorporated discreetly, such as through an embossed logo or a monochromatic pattern. The bag’s overall style and functionality should align with professional norms, emphasizing practicality and organizational features over overt thematic elements. Material quality and durability are also crucial considerations for long-term use.

Question 2: How can the authenticity of a licensed item featuring Disney characters be verified?

Genuine items will bear official licensing marks, such as hangtags, labels, or holographic stickers, indicating authorization from The Walt Disney Company. These markings typically include copyright information and licensing details. Purchasing from authorized retailers or reputable sources minimizes the risk of acquiring counterfeit products. Discrepancies in material quality, stitching, or printing may also indicate a lack of authenticity.

Question 3: What materials offer optimal durability for bags subjected to daily wear and tear?

High-denier nylon and ballistic nylon are recognized for their exceptional resistance to abrasion and tearing. Reinforced stitching at stress points and durable zippers further contribute to the bag’s longevity. Leather accents, if present, should be of high quality and properly treated to withstand exposure to the elements. Selecting materials that offer water resistance or water repellency is also advisable for protecting contents from moisture damage.

Question 4: How does character selection impact the overall appeal to male consumers?

Character selection must align with the age, interests, and preferences of the intended male demographic. Characters from established franchises with broad appeal, such as “Star Wars” or Marvel, are often well-received. More nuanced or subtle character representations may appeal to older consumers seeking a balance between thematic expression and professional appropriateness. Characters perceived as childish or overly feminine may diminish the product’s desirability among male consumers.

Question 5: What organizational features enhance the functionality and usability of carrying solutions?

Multiple compartments, including dedicated padded sleeves for laptops or tablets, facilitate efficient organization of electronic devices and documents. Internal and external pockets, including water bottle holders, provide convenient storage for smaller items. Key clips and pen loops further enhance organizational capabilities. The arrangement of compartments should promote balanced weight distribution and easy access to frequently used items.

Question 6: What are the recommended cleaning and maintenance procedures for prolonging the life of character-themed bags?

Adhering to the manufacturer’s care instructions is paramount. Spot cleaning with a mild detergent and a soft cloth is generally recommended for addressing stains and spills. Machine washing may be permissible for certain materials, but it is crucial to consult the product label beforehand. Exposure to direct sunlight should be minimized to prevent fading or discoloration. Proper storage, such as in a dust bag, protects the bag from dust and abrasion when not in use.
